FIGURE 10. Cardiodectes bertrandi n in Three new species of the family Pennellidae (Copepoda: Siphonostomatoida) from gobiid fishes (Actinopterygii: Perciformes) in coastal waters of the western Pacific Ocean

FIGURE 10. Cardiodectes bertrandi n. sp., female, holotype MNHN–Cp 6047. A, cephalothorax with digitiform processes removed and neck region, ventral (drawn from a paratype, NSMT–Cr 21195), p1 = leg 1, p2 = leg 2, p3 = leg 3; B, antennule, posterior; C, antenna, posterior; D, maxillule; E, maxilla, anterior; F, leg 1 (drawn from a paratype, NSMT–Cr 21195); G, leg 2 (drawn from a paratype, NSMT–Cr 21195); H, leg 3 (drawn from a paratype, NSMT–Cr 21195). Scale bars: A, 400μm; B, F, G, H, 30μm; C, D, E, 20μm.

FIGURE 1 in A new species of Cardiodectes Wilson C.B., 1917 (Copepoda: Siphonostomatoida Pennellidae) from Spinyjaw greeneye, Chlorophthalmus corniger Alcock, 1894 off the Indian Ocean

FIGURE 1. Attachment sites of mature post-metamorphic adult females of Cardiodectes vampire sp. nov., on Spinyjaw greeneye, Chlorophthalmus corniger Alcock, 1894. A, on the upper and lower jaws (arrows); B, on the dorsal and dorso-lateral body surface between eyes and dorsal fin (arrows); C, dorsal surface of the host's head, carrying the parasite which induced a swelling on the head (arrow); D, lateral body surface (arrows).
